Aquamania runs a high speed ferry over to St. Barts. Check in is 8 and return time is 4:45. Even if you made it over to the Simpson Bay area where it leaves from by 8:45 it is the arrival back at 4:45 which would put you back at the ship probably around 5:30-6 if all goes as planned. None of the other ways that I know of are even this close to your port schedule.

 

The ferry to Anguilla is doable though if you are interested in visiting that island. It would be a pretty rushed trip IMHO, but it is doable.

Ferry ride over to Barts can be extremely rough. One of the ferries, Voyager, is sometimes called the "vomit comet".

 

Commuter flights out of Grand Case (St. Barth Commuter) and Julianna (Winair) might be another option. Only 10-15 minutes, not cheap, but you're on a ship schedule. The runway at Barts is one of the more challenging ones in the world...

A lot to do without leaving SXM, not that much at SBH, and everything there is $$$$...
